Background
A simple apparatus for assisting walking is usually a wooden or metal stick, a walking stick is an important medical rehabilitation aid, and comprises a walking stick, an elbow stick and an axillary stick, wherein the walking stick is mainly used for mild needs, such as the elderly or mountaineers, the walking stick does not belong to articles for disabled persons, and the elbow stick belongs to articles for middle-lower-limb disabled persons.
The patient that the shank is injured is when using traditional walking stick walking, because general walking stick structure is comparatively simple, and the bottom leans on simple and fixed knot to construct fulcrum structure and ground contact, thereby the patient need hard upwards lift corresponding shank forward movement again, there is the painful hidden danger in wound during the operation, it makes impracticality to add electromechanical drive structure to go on the operation that the shank does not have the platform and move forward simultaneously on simple structure, and only can increase the weight of walking stick, be unfavorable for the use, thereby lack and to reach the power structure that corresponding drive walking stick bottom moved on traditional walking stick structural basis and solve above-mentioned problem. Therefore, a crutch capable of reducing the times of leg injury caused by forceful lifting is provided for solving the problems.

Referring to fig. 1-4, the crutch for reducing times of leg injury caused by lifting with force comprises a circular tube 1, a transmission structure and a moving structure, wherein two plastic pulleys 2 are symmetrically installed in ports at two ends of the circular tube 1, and a cylindrical frame 6 is installed in a communication manner at a port at the top of the circular tube 1;
the transmission structure comprises a first gear 7, a second gear 11 and an internal tooth transmission belt 8, the first gear 7 is rotatably installed in the cylindrical frame 6, one end of a shaft lever on one side of the first gear 7 penetrates through the outer circular surface of the cylindrical frame 6 and is installed at one end of the rocker 3, the second gear 11 is assembled in the middle of the first circular lever 10, the second gear 11 is in transmission connection with the first gear 7 through the internal tooth transmission belt 8, and the internal tooth transmission belt 8 is partially located in the circular tube 1;
remove structure includes bar case 12, second round bar 13 and rubber gyro wheel 14, 1 one end of pipe is installed in bar case 12 top intermediate position intercommunication, second round bar 13 is equipped with two, and two second round bar 13 rotates respectively and installs between bar incasement 12 interior both ends lateral wall, rubber gyro wheel 14 is installed respectively and is being corresponded 10 both ends of first round bar and 13 both ends of second round bar.
The two sides of the annular surface of the circular tube 1 and the middle annular surface between the two sides are both vertically provided with different numbers of internal thread hole grooves 9 at equal intervals, two of the internal thread hole grooves 9 of the middle annular surface between the two sides of the circular tube 1 are fixedly connected with the same pedal 15 through two screws, and a patient can conveniently place a foot bottom plate on the pedal 15 after the height is adjusted through the installed pedal 15; the first round rods 10 are rotatably installed on two side walls of the middle part in the strip-shaped box 12, two ends of each first round rod 10 and two ends of each second round rod 13 penetrate through the corresponding side surfaces of the strip-shaped box 12, and the two second round rods 13 are respectively rotatably installed between the side walls of the two ends in the strip-shaped box 12, so that the effect of installing the rubber rollers 14 positioned on the two sides of the strip-shaped box 12 is achieved; both sides of the circular tube 1 are fixedly connected with one end of the corresponding side rod 4 through screws, and the screws penetrate through one end of the side rod 4 and are connected in the corresponding internal thread hole grooves 9 in a threaded manner, so that one ends of the two side rods 4 with well-adjusted positions and heights can be fixed, and the two side rods 1 and the bearing rod 5 form a triangular structure; two side rods 4 are arranged, a bearing rod 5 is arranged between the top ends of the two side rods 4, and a sponge block is wrapped on the surface of the bearing rod 5, so that a supporting pad can be conveniently supported in the armpit of a user; all roll between two plastic pulleys 2 in the port of 1 top of pipe and between two plastic pulleys 2 in the port of bottom and paste and lean on and have 8 outside surfaces of internal tooth drive belt, 8 parts of internal tooth drive belt are located pipe 1, reach the effect of avoiding 1 port edge of internal tooth drive belt 8 and pipe to take place the friction.
The utility model discloses when using, at first put the carrier bar 5 that has the sponge piece of parcel in the armpit of required support, and put the sole plate of injured leg on the footboard 15 of having adjusted the height, when the healthy shank of patient steps on ground impetus forward and need move injured leg forward, manual rotation rocker 3 drives the first gear 7 rotation of plastics material, because first gear 7 leads the transmission of internal tooth drive belt 8 and the second gear 11 transmission of plastics material to know and drive the second gear 11 rotation of assembling on first round bar 10, thereby realized the transmission function of drive power, and the operation is light and handy convenient, corresponding transmission structure part alleviates holistic quality for the steel structure or the plastic construction of light in quality simultaneously;
at this moment, the first rotating round rod 10 drives the rubber rollers 14 at the two ends to roll on the ground, meanwhile, the rubber rollers 14 serving as the initiative in the middle of the strip-shaped box 12 roll on the ground under the action of the rolling on the ground, the effect of correspondingly moving the strip-shaped box 12 on the ground is achieved, and the pedal 15 also moves in the same direction, so that the leg supported on the pedal 15 can be horizontally moved forward to one side of the acting point of the front foot, and the strength of the force when the injured leg is lifted to move is reduced.
